期刊文献+

基于VBA开发技术的接口测试技术研究 被引量:5

Research on Interface Testing Technology Based on VBA Technology
下载PDF
导出
摘要 对于软件系统来说,接口是连通所有配置项的桥梁。系统的接口一旦发生异常,轻则导致整个系统的运行不畅,严重的会导致系统无法正常工作,其风险性不言而喻。因此在软件开发阶段尽可能地发现接口缺陷可以大大降低软件成本,并提升软件的稳定性。但是当前针对配置项间的接口测试主要依靠网络上的一些网络口/串口报文收发工具。这些工具虽然能满足基本的报文收发功能,却无法从测试的角度针对各个报文字段灵活地生成正常/异常测试数据并根据测试需要灵活收发。文中探讨了接口测试需求,并在此基础上给出了通过VBA技术实现的工具实例。 For the software system, the interface is the bridge for all the configuration items. In case that the interface of the system is ab- normal,it will cause the operation of the whole system which is not smooth,it will even cause the whole system can' t work normally. Its risk is self-evident. Therefore, discovering the bugs of interface in the software development period as much as possible can greatly reduce the cost of the software, and enhance the stability of the software. But the interface of the testing for the configuration items mainly relies on some network ports on the Intemet or serial messaging tools. Although these tools can satisfy the basic function of the message receiv- ing and sending,it can' t create flexibly the normal or abnormal testing data from the view of testing each message field and it can' t re- ceive and send flexibly according to testing needs. It discusses the interface testing requirements and then gives the tool cases through the VBA technology which has practical reference value.
作者 刘春裕
出处 《计算机技术与发展》 2014年第1期69-72,76,共5页 Computer Technology and Development
基金 中国人民解放军总装备部项目(51319080202)
关键词 VBA 接口测试 缺陷 测试工具 VBA interface testing bug testing tool
  • 相关文献

参考文献12

二级参考文献22

  • 1王文东,耿国华,张根耀.软件可靠性保证与评测技术[J].微机发展,2004,14(11):104-106. 被引量:6
  • 2佘凤.软件测试及关键技术[J].黄冈职业技术学院学报,2007,9(1):95-98. 被引量:2
  • 3David Lee, Mihalis Yannakakis. Principles and Methods of Testing Finite State Machines - A Survey[J]. In Proceedings of the IEEE,1996,84:1090- 1 123.
  • 4Claude Jard, Thierry Jeeron. TGV: Theory, Principles and Algorithms[J]. STTT,2005,7(4) :297 - 315.
  • 5Robert M Hierons. Testing from a Z Specification[J]. The Journal of Software Testing, Verification, and Reliability, 1997,7(1) :19 - 33.
  • 6Fletcher R,Sajeev A S M. A Framework for Testing Object Oriented Software Using Formal Specifications. In Reliable Software Technologies (Ada - Europe '96), Lecture Notes in Computer Science, Mont reux, Switzerland, 1996 : 159 - 170.
  • 7Paul E Black. Modeling and Marshaling: Making Tests from Model Checker Counterexamples[C]. In Proceedings of the 19th Digital Avionics Systems Conferences (DASC), Z000, 1 :1B3/1 - 1B3/6.
  • 8Paul Ammann,Paul E Black. A Specification- based Coverage Metric to Evaluate Test Sets[J]. In HASE, 1999, IEEE Computer Society, 1999 : 239 - 248.
  • 9Paul Ammann, Paul E Black, William Majurski. Using Model Checking to Generate Tests from Specifications. In ICF - EM, 1998.
  • 10Kuhn D R. Fault Classes and Error Detection in Specification based Testing. ACM Transactions on Software Engineering Methodology, 1999,8 (4).

共引文献34

同被引文献31

引证文献5

二级引证文献15

相关作者

内容加载中请稍等...

相关机构

内容加载中请稍等...

相关主题

内容加载中请稍等...

浏览历史

内容加载中请稍等...
;
使用帮助 返回顶部